6. Episode 6: Easel Peasel Lemon Weasel
27:22||Season 1, Ep. 6Laura is thrilled that Inside the Lines has been nominated for the Turner Prize for ‘Weasel Getting Ready for Bed’. She can’t wait to go to London and see if they’ve won. Paul just wants to complete the shop’s tax return in peace and in tune with the autumn equinox.Thankfully, they have a perfect guide in a loquacious gallery owner and devoted fan who is ready to usher them into the baffling world of contemporary art.Complications ensue.Created and performed by Laura Mugridge & Paul MacauleyThis episode is co-devised and performed with Miles Mlambo as the exuberant and deeply passionate Maurice Mojosian.Original music by Tom AdamsSound Design & Production by Gwen ThomsonEdited by Paul Macauley & Gwen ThomsonAnnouncer: Jessica CroweArtwork: Hannah Broadwaywww.hannahbroadway.comProduced by Hello Strawberry in Brighton & HoveVisit the Inside the Lines Online Shop! https://tinyurl.com/ycy7ktfh
